Cash-out refinancing lenders in Fayette County

30 cash-out refinancing mortgages were made in Fayette County, Iowa, in 2025, by 24 lenders. The median rate their borrowers got was 6.490% on a median loan of $85,000. Of 59 decisions, 26 were denials — 44.1%, most often for credit history.

Counts, medians and denial shares are computed from the Home Mortgage Disclosure Act loan-level file for 2025, published by the Consumer Financial Protection Bureau through the FFIEC: every application a covered lender received, as the lender reported it. A median rate is what borrowers got, not what you will be offered — it depends on the loan, the property, your credit and the market on the day, and no figure here is a quote. A median over fewer than 10 loans is not shown: it is a number with no meaning and a real person's rate half-exposed. Those cells say "under 10 loans" and the count is still published.
